Screen Shot 2015-09-14 at 11.03.13 AMNew York and London- American International Group (NYSE: AIG), Major Global Sponsor of the All Blacks, is bringing rugby fans closer to the haka than ever before, with the launch of its innovative virtual reality (VR) Haka 360º Experience.

The Haka 360˚ Experience is an app which uses 360 degree video technology to give the viewer the feeling of being on the field with the All Blacks and in the midst of the powerful Māori ritual.

Designed for smartphones, the Haka 360˚ Experience is available to download via the App Store or Google Play from today (Saturday September 12, 2015). Users can view the video on their handset or immerse themselves in the VR experience with a custom made Haka 360˚ headset.

About the All Blacks

The All Blacks are New Zealand’s national rugby team and the most successful international rugby team of all time. With a winning percentage of 76.4 over 526 tests (1903-2014) they are noted as one of the most prolific teams across any sport. Known for their strength, performance and tenacity, the All Blacks are an icon of New Zealand culture, and are recognised both nationally and internationally as sporting heroes. AIG has been the Major Global Sponsor and Official Insurance Partner of the All Blacks since 2012.
